Comparison review

The Xiaomi Poco M2 Pro is just a bit better than Moto Z Force, having a score of 78.7 against 75.8. These phones come with Android OS, but Xiaomi Poco M2 Pro has an older 10 version and Moto Z Force has Android 7.0 Nougat. Xiaomi Poco M2 Pro's body is newer, but thicker and noticeably heavier than Moto Z Force.

The Moto Z Force counts with a bit sharper screen than Xiaomi Poco M2 Pro, because although it has a little smaller display, it also counts with a better resolution of 1440 x 2560 pixels and a better pixel density. Xiaomi Poco M2 Pro features a bit faster processor than Moto Z Force, and although they both have the same RAM memory amount, the Xiaomi Poco M2 Pro also has a larger number of cores.

Moto Z Force features a lot bigger memory capacity to install games and applications than Xiaomi Poco M2 Pro, and although they both have exactly the same 64 GB internal storage capacity, the Moto Z Force also has a SD card slot that supports up to 1,95 TB. The Xiaomi Poco M2 Pro counts with a much better camera than Moto Z Force, and although they both have the same 30 frames per second video frame rates, the same (4K) video resolution and a F1.8 aperture, the Xiaomi Poco M2 Pro also has a lot higher 48 megapixels resolution back facing camera.

Xiaomi Poco M2 Pro counts with a very superior battery performance than Moto Z Force, because it has a 5000mAh battery size instead of 3500mAh.
